In an era where ‘Make in India’ is more than a slogan, Mr. Mustafa Bundiwala, Partner at Indian Rubber Industry, is turning vision into reality.

 

An entrepreneur with over five years in the power tools sector, Mr. Bundiwala first made his mark as a trader. Working hand-in-hand with international brands, he sourced and imported products from across the globe — an experience that sharpened his eye for global quality standards, customer expectations, and fast-shifting market demands.

But trading was only the beginning.

 

Today, Mr. Bundiwala has taken a bold leap — from importing to innovating. With a clear mission to manufacture world-class industrial rubber products in India, he’s bridging the gap between global benchmarks and local capability. His move reflects a deeper belief: India doesn’t just consume quality, it can create it.

 

By setting up advanced manufacturing, he aims to serve industries that demand precision, durability, and trust — all while generating jobs and reducing import dependency.
